I received the following email via our press email address. It seems slow election processing in Estonia was blamed on the Postgres database. Any idea how to respond to this? --------------------------------------------------------------------------- Hello, There was parliament elections in Estonia last sunday. Everything else went fine except the system lagged for most important hours during entering the votes from the departments. Helmes (www.helmes.ee), the developer of many other national systems, released a note to media on Monday accusing Postgresql database that it did not manage with the dataflow. Although to calculate for a second, then about 600 inserting people from the election departments who pass totally 50'000 rows to tables during two hours is a very slow day for most sql-systems. They mainly need only the next information for voting - department, candidate, total votes. So the real fault was in the brain of the database developer - it is silly to say subaru is bad if you cant drive rally-style and crash the car in the first corner. I hope Postgresql management will take action on this and give a reply in media, as accuses were against "freeware databases" - issues like this give them bad reputation and these databases wont be taken seriously the next time. I have used postgre and mysql for ten years to build up photobanks with millions of pictures inside and developed other large systems and met no mistakes, it all begins with good database design.
